How to Prepare Broccolini for Stir Fry

Stir-frying broccolini is a quick and delicious way to enjoy this nutritious vegetable. Not only is it a great way to add flavor and texture to your meal, but it also retains the vegetable’s vibrant color and nutrients.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to prepare broccolini for stir fry.

1. Selecting the Broccolini

First, choose fresh broccolini with bright green, firm stalks and tight florets. Avoid any that have wilted leaves or soft stalks, as these may indicate that the vegetable is past its prime.

2. Cleaning the Broccolini

Rinse the broccolini under cold running water to remove any dirt or debris. Gently shake off the excess water and pat the stalks dry with a paper towel.

3. Trimming the Broccolini

Trim the bottom inch or so of the broccolini stalks with a sharp knife. This helps to remove any tough or fibrous parts. If you prefer, you can also peel the outer layer of the stalks with a vegetable peeler to make them more tender.

4. Cutting the Broccolini

Once the broccolini is trimmed, cut it into bite-sized pieces. You can cut the stalks into 1-inch sections and the florets into smaller pieces. This will ensure that the broccolini cooks evenly when stir-fried.

5. Preparing the Stir Fry Sauce

While the broccolini is being prepared, you can mix up a simple stir fry sauce. A classic combination is soy sauce, sesame oil, and a touch of sugar or rice vinegar. Adjust the flavors to your preference by adding garlic, ginger, or other spices.

6. Stir-Frying the Broccolini

Heat a wok or large skillet over high heat. Add a small amount of oil, such as vegetable or sesame oil, and swirl it around to coat the surface. Add the prepared broccolini to the wok and stir-fry for about 2-3 minutes, or until the stalks are tender-crisp and the florets are bright green. Add the stir fry sauce during the last minute of cooking, stirring constantly to coat the broccolini evenly.

7. Serving the Stir-Fried Broccolini

Once the broccolini is cooked to your liking, remove it from the heat and transfer it to a serving plate. Serve the stir-fried broccolini as a side dish or alongside your favorite protein, such as chicken, shrimp, or tofu.
